What Are Digital Identity Platforms?

Digital identity platforms are systems designed to create, verify, and manage digital identities. These identities consist of personal data such as names, birthdates, biometric details, and other identifying attributes. Through secure verification processes, these platforms allow users to access services without repeatedly confirming their identity, whether logging into a bank account or using government resources. They provide a unified and trusted digital identity that simplifies interactions across multiple services.

Streamlining Access Across Different Services

One of the biggest benefits of digital identity platforms is the simplification of access. Traditional authentication can be cumbersome, involving passwords, PINs, and manual checks. Digital identity platforms combine these steps through technologies like single sign-on (SSO), biometric authentication, and secure tokens, reducing friction and improving the overall user experience.

Furthermore, these platforms enable interoperability, letting users move effortlessly between sectors such as healthcare, finance, education, and travel—without repeated verification. This capability is increasingly important in a globalized world where remote access and mobility are the norm.

Security Powered by Cutting-Edge Technologies

Security is central to digital identity platforms. By harnessing blockchain, biometrics, machine learning, and multi-factor authentication, they provide strong defenses against fraud and unauthorized access.

Biometrics rely on unique physical features like fingerprints or facial patterns, which are far harder to steal or mimic than passwords. Blockchain technology decentralizes identity data, minimizing centralized breach risks and giving users more control over their personal information. Meanwhile, machine learning algorithms analyze behaviors and data patterns to detect anomalies and flag suspicious activities proactively.

Challenges and Important Considerations

Despite their strengths, digital identity platforms face notable challenges. Privacy remains a major concern, especially when handling sensitive biometric or personal data. Compliance with regulations such as GDPR and CCPA is vital, ensuring users understand how their data is used and maintain control over their digital identities.

Widespread adoption also depends on building trust among institutions and individuals. This requires transparent governance, standardized protocols, and consistent performance across various applications. Earning and sustaining user trust demands rigorous security, reliability, and ethical data practices.

Real-World Applications and Impact

Digital identity platforms are already transforming many sectors. In banking and fintech, they facilitate secure onboarding and regulatory compliance, lowering fraud and costs. Healthcare providers use them to safeguard patient data sharing. Governments rely on these platforms to streamline access to benefits, voting, and tax systems. Educational institutions verify student identities during exams, and the travel industry is exploring digital passports to speed up border controls.

Together, these applications create a more efficient, secure, and user-friendly digital ecosystem.

Looking Ahead: The Future of Digital Identity

As technology advances, digital identity platforms will continue to evolve, incorporating AI, real-time data analysis, and global interoperability standards. A promising direction is the rise of self-sovereign identities—digital IDs fully controlled by individuals without centralized oversight.
